In Japan, there is an anime called Love Live! It’s about schoolgirl idols. It’s more than just popular. Way more.

Picture: S1Amk

As Twitter user S1Amk shows, a Sega arcade in Osaka Prefecture set up a special area where Love Live! fans can prostrate themselves (bow completely down in what’s called “dogeza” or 土下座 in Japanese) before the characters and make offerings.

Keep in mind, with a lot of this fandom, the worshipping element is tongue-in-cheek. This is a fun way for fans to show how hardcore they are. And Love Live! fans can certainly be hardcore. (It’s also a clever way for Sega to promote its Love Live! collaborations.)

On Twitter, some noted that this was also a way for the arcade employees to get free snacks and cakes. Hey, somebody has to eat those offerings!
